What’s the average price of jeans?
But the average price paid for a pair of jeans in the U.S. is well under $50. According to a 2010 survey conducted by ShopSmart, women paid $34 per pair on average, and only 1 in 10 has blown $100 or more for a pair of jeans.

How much are 501 jeans worth?
The earliest pair of 501s that I’ve come across currently for sale is a pair 1902 501XX priced at around $35,000 in good vintage condition.
What is the most expensive pair of jeans?
Gucci Jeans – $3,100
Gucci jeans have actually appeared in the Guinness Book of World Records as the most expensive jeans in the world, with price tags going up to $3,100, but most of them are priced at just around $600.

How long should a pair of jeans last?
The average lifespan for a pair of jeans, according to the International Fabric Institute Fair Claims Guide, is 2-3 years. But there are a few factors that can either make jeans fall short of that standard or outlast it by years.
Why are 7 jeans so expensive?
By using higher quality materials and tailoring their jeans to have a less stiff, softer and more comfortable fit, 7 for All Mankind revolutionized denim to bring a premium product to everyone. However, at well over $100 a pair, it’s not necessarily true that everyone can afford to wear them.

What is the difference between cheap jeans and expensive jeans?
According to Slowey, one of the biggest difference between cheap and expensive jeans is the fabric. “Denim starts out like burlap, and through expensive processing, designers are able to make them feel like soft cotton,” reveals Slowey, Elle’s fashion news director.
Why are jeans so popular still today?
Denim garments remain popular in part due to their durability. A high-quality pair of jeans can last for years or even decades, and these types of pants look better as they age, which adds to their appeal.

When should I buy new jeans?
Most experts will agree you should discard your favorite jeans when they no longer fit, wear out in the seat or crotch, or have rips that aren’t in optimal places. Wear and tear is inevitable, but being strategic about how you clean your denim can extend its lifespan.
What is the small pocket on Levis for?
The tiny pockets on jeans and some other pants were designed for pocket watches. They were first used with the original Levi’s “waist overalls” jeans in 1890. People don’t use pocket watches anymore, but the pockets are still around.
